Boaz Vaadia’s stunning sculpture, Yo’ah with Dog can be seen in the August issue of Art + Auction magazine. The work features in an article about the collector Jorge Perez, and is pictured in situ within the grounds of his magnificent home. As a board member of the new Miami Art Museum, Perez’s collection has become more international in recent years, focusing increasingly on emerging and contemporary artists such as Vaadia.

Shani Rhys James came to prominence in the early 1990’s and is considered a Welsh national treasure. She won the Jerwood painting prize in 2003 and was awarded an M.B.E. in the New Years Honours List in 2006. Her works are held in major national collections in England and Wales, and many private collections both in the UK and internationally.

Geoff Uglow has won the 20th Alastair Salvesen Painting and Travel Scholarship

William Daniell, "Dunsky Castle, near Port Patrick, Wigtonshire" in "A Voyage round the Coasts of Scotland and the adjacent Isles" 1816

Geoff Uglow, "2Nos", 2008
The award comprises £10,000 for a project of his choosing and a solo Exhibition at Royal Scottish Academy in Edinburgh. It is one of the most prestigious awards in Scotland.
Following in the footsteps of 19th century artist and engraver William Daniell, Uglow will recreate his extensive journeys around Scotland’s coastline. Sketching 150 sites from Gretna and Orkney to North Berwick, Uglow will produce paintings and prints which form a visual record of the coast, in emulation of Daniell’s book of illustrations and engravings, published in 1814.
